Leidos

Build Engineer

Leidos

full-time

Posted on:

Location Type: Remote

Location: United States

Visit company website

Explore more

AI Apply
Apply

Salary

💰 $92,300 - $166,850 per year

Job Level

About the role

  • Design and establish configuration management documentation.
  • Identify and establish baselines and configuration items.
  • Perform software builds as well as authorize the release of software builds and changes specified by Program or Engineering leadership.
  • Create and maintain build environments and develop and execute build scripts and test automation (DevOps).
  • Develop scripts and automate processes to improve efficiencies and accuracy of the software build and release processes.
  • Provide software configuration management support to software teams.
  • Perform administration and user support, development, and maintenance for the configuration management toolset.
  • Perform as configuration management support on various program assignments to include Software CM and/or Hardware CM and Data Management responsibilities.
  • Research, design and implement new software configuration management tools from the ground-up to automate and release software applications.
  • Participate in Working Groups and IPTs, informal and formal technical interchanges, and formal reviews.

Requirements

  • Bachelor’s degree in a related field and 8-12 years of related experience or a Master’s degree in a related field with 6-10 years of related experience.
  • US citizenship and an active Secret security clearance, with ability to obtain a Top Secret clearance.
  • Experience managing Git-based software repositories (versioning, branching, merging) and binary artifact repositories.
  • Development experience with scripting languages (e.g., Bash, Python, PowerShell, Perl, Groovy, Make).
  • Experience in fast-paced continuous change integration environments.
  • Continuous integration/continuous deployment (CI/CD) experience in software release automation in Agile development process.
  • Proven ability to define and implement Software Configuration Management processes in an enterprise environment.
  • Ability to develop effective cross-functional working relationships.
Benefits
  • Health and Wellness programs
  • Income Protection
  • Paid Leave
  • Retirement
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
configuration managementsoftware buildsbuild environmentsbuild scriptstest automationscripting languagescontinuous integrationcontinuous deploymentsoftware configuration management processesGit-based software repositories
Soft Skills
cross-functional working relationships
Certifications
Bachelor’s degreeMaster’s degreeSecret security clearanceTop Secret clearance